1The barren stalk2 Gene Is Required for Axillary Meristem Development in Maize显示文摘The diversity of plant architecture is determined by axillary meristems (AMs). AMs are produced from small groups of stem cells in the axils of leaf primordia and generate vegetative branches and reproductive inflorescences . Previous studies identified genes critical for AM development that function in auxin biosynthesis, transport, and signaling. barren stalkl (ba1), a basic helix-loop-helix transcription factor, acts downstream of auxin to control AM formation. Here, we report the cloning and characterization of barren stalk2 (ba2), a mutant that fails to produce ears and has fewer branches and spikelets in the tassel, indicating that ba2 functions in reproductive AM development. Furthermore, the ba2 mutation suppresses tiller growth in the teosinte branchedl mutant, indicating that ba2 also plays an essential role in vegetative AM development. The ba2 gene encodes a protein that co-localizes and heterodimerizes with BA1 in the nucleus . Characterization of the genetic interaction between ba2 and ba1 demonstrates that ba1 shows a gene dosage effect in ba2 mutants, providing further evidence that BA1 and BA2 act together in the same pathway. Characterization of the molecular and genetic interaction between ba2 and additional genes required for the regulation of ba1 further supports this finding. 2Auxin EvoDevo: Conservation and Diversification of Genes Regulating Auxin Biosynthesis, Transport, and Signaling显示文摘The phytohormone auxin has been shown to be of pivotal importance in growth and development of land plants.The underlying molecular players involved in auxin biosynthesis, transport, and signaling are quite well understood in Arabidopsis.However, functional characterizations of auxin-related genes in economically important crops, specifically maize and rice, are still limited.In this article, we comprehensively review recent functional studies on auxirelated genes in both maize and rice, compared with what is known in Arabidopsis, and highlight conservation and diversification of their functions.
